Menu hamburger do lado esquerdo no celular

Obrigado @benji e @featheredtoast

Ainda apresentando um comportamento estranho, infelizmente

Com o menu hambúrguer do lado esquerdo no celular desativado:

Com ele ativado:

Note a posição do ícone de chat…

1 curtida

Entendi, o ícone não estava sendo atribuído à sua área designada. Atualizado novamente!

Infelizmente, ainda não está funcionando. Novo screenshot com a versão mais recente do menu hambúrguer do lado esquerdo no celular ativado:

Fiz um PR para corrigir o problema do botão de login não estar alinhado com outros botões do cabeçalho quando o usuário não está logado.

Antes:

Depois:

@fokx ótimo, obrigado! Essa linha em particular também é onde muitas das alterações pendentes foram configuradas, então puxei suas alterações separadamente, fora do PR.

@Robin.Grant Atualizei o tema para alinhar melhor os ícones de cabeçalho personalizados - experimente este


2 curtidas

Incrível! - obrigado @featheredtoast - parece estar funcionando perfeitamente!

1 curtida

Olá
Este componente será atualizado? Encontrei um problema. Quando defino um status personalizado e adiciono um ícone, clicar no avatar faz com que o ícone se mova para a posição errada.

1 curtida

Faz um tempo que não olho para este componente, vou cuidar disso agora que o cabeçalho foi refatorado…

Dito isso, fico feliz em receber PRs ou similares se alguém resolver isso antes de mim.

5 curtidas

Encontrei este TC que não funciona após uma alteração recente no core, então abri um PR:

4 curtidas

Legal! Obrigado pela PR, eu a mesclei :slight_smile:

2 curtidas

Olá @featheredtoast Após a atualização recente, não funciona do meu lado :sweat_smile:

A atualização foi sugerida para ser revertida devido a uma reversão principal recente aqui: Revert "UX: Adjust appearance of search icon (#34235)" (#34469) · discourse/discourse@22f8f6d · GitHub

2 curtidas

Não acho que a funcionalidade do logotipo central esteja funcionando no momento; pelo menos, não parece fazer nada em nosso novo site.

A propósito, este componente é brilhante! O comportamento padrão de ter o :hamburger: à direita no celular está simplesmente errado. Houve alguma discussão adicional sobre isso?

5 curtidas

Sim, a configuração para centralizar o logotipo não funciona aqui também.

1 curtida

Posso confirmar que, após habilitar o TC na versão 3.5.1, o ícone do hambúrguer permanece no lado direito do cabeçalho em dispositivos móveis.

O meu não - essa parte da funcionalidade está funcionando perfeitamente para mim.

O problema que mencionei acima é sobre a posição do logo (não do menu hambúrguer).

Você testou no 3.5 ou 3.6? No nosso 3.5.1 estável, o componente de tema não funciona. No 3.6, ele funciona, no entanto.

Editar: Encontrei o problema! Se alguém no 3.5.1 quiser usar este componente, use este commit: GitHub - featheredtoast/discourse-left-menu-theme-component at 707abce8558065abd6e59a92da3f2cd22d9d0a8a

1 curtida